* WHAT...Flooding is possible.
* WHERE...The Cedar River at Janesville, or from Quarter Section Run
west of Denver to the West Fork Cedar River.
* WHEN...From Saturday morning to Saturday evening.
* IMPACTS...At 12.0 feet, Widespread lowland flooding occurs
especially within the city park. The flooding covers approximately
6000 acres.
At 13.0 feet, Water affects W 3rd St and may result in evacuation
of a trailer court in Janesville. Water also affects much of the
Janesville city park as well as nearby gravel roads.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
- At 1:45 PM CDT Thursday the stage was 3.7 feet.
- Forecast...Flood stage may be reached late Saturday morning.
- Flood stage is 13.0 feet.
